> I have added a new TsFileIOWriter, which supports to recover data from a
> broken TsFile (I mean, a TsFile that is not closed correctly). The PR is
> https://github.com/apache/incubator-iotdb/pull/87.
>
> You can use the new feature by:
> ```
>     NativeRestorableIOWriter rWriter = new NativeRestorableIOWriter(file);
>     TsFileWriter writer = new TsFileWriter(rWriter);
> ```
> 1. If the file is a complete TsFile (e.g., the FileMetadata has been
> persistent into the file and the tail magic string is correct), then you
> can not write data into this TsFile anymore (actually I can remove all
> FileMetadata and then let you continue to write, but it needs more coding
> work...), `TsFileWriter writer = new TsFileWriter(rWriter);` will throw a
> IoException. You can check it before you create TsFileWriter by using
> `rWriter.canWrite()`.
>
> 2. ChunkGroup is the basic unit that can be recover. That is, if a
> ChunkGroup is complete, i.e., its chunkGroupFooter is complete, I will
> remain it, otherwise I will truncate the chunk group. However, I can not
> know whether a chunkGroupFooter is complete (if only one byte lose, the
> deserialize method does not throw exception, because  something like
> `deserializeToInt(inputstream)` does not throw exception (it will use 3
> bytes to convert them to a integer).  So, when I say "if a ChunkGroup is
> complete", I mean that not only its chunkGroupFooter  is serialized
> successfully, but also there is at least one more byte is serialized into
> the file followed the footer.
>
> 3. I have tested many cases, such only a magic head string is persisted,
> only a ChunkHeader is persisted,  the first ChunkHeader is not persisted
> completely, only some Chunks are persisted, a ChunkGroupFooter is
> persisted, Two ChunkGroupFooter are persisted, and a complete TsFile is
> persisted, etc..  (`NativeRestorableIOWriterTest.java`, hope I have cover
> all cases)

> >     >     >     TsFile API is not deprecated. In fact, it is designed for
> > this
> >     >     > scenario and
> >     >     >     MapReduce/Spark computing.
> >     >     >
> >     >     >     If you just use Reader and Writer API, there is something
> > you
> >     > need to
> >     >     > know:
> >     >     >
> >     >     >     Let's suppose your block size is x Bytes,
> >     > (tsfile-format.properties:
> >     >     >     group_size_in_byte).
> >     >     >
> >     >     >     1. If you write data and a shutdown occurs, then all data
> > that is
> >     >     > flushed
> >     >     >     on disk is ok, and you can read the data ( class
> >     >     >     org.apache.iotdb.tsfile.TsFileSequenceRead is an example,
> > but
> >     > you need
> >     >     > to
> >     >     >     change it a little. I think I can write an example.)
> >     >     >
> >     >     >     2. Actually, TsFile has the ability to allow you continue
> > to
> >     > write
> >     >     > data at
> >     >     >     the end of the incomplete file. However, We do not
> provide
> > this
> >     > API
> >     >     > now...
> >     >     >     If needed, I can add the API.
> >     >     >
> >     >     >     3. In this scenario, you will lose at most x Bytes data.
> > If you
> >     > do not
> >     >     >     accept that, something like WAL is needed. (It is not
> very
> >     > complex,
> >     >     > but I
> >     >     >     am not sure that whether it should be an embedded
> function
> > for
> >     > TsFile).
> >     >     >
> >     >     >     Up to now, we can consider that TsFile API is suitable
> for
> > your
> >     >     > scenario
> >     >     >     (even though we need to add a little more API if you
> > desire).
> >     > And you
> >     >     > can
> >     >     >     get the ability to compress data, and query data from the
> > TsFile
> >     > rather
> >     >     >     than scan the data from the head to the tail.
> >     >     >
> >     >     >     However, TsFile has one constraint: You can not write
> >     > out-of-order data
> >     >     >     into a TsFile, otherwise the query API may return
> > incomplete
> >     > result.
> >     >     >     But I think it is ok for real applications, because I do
> > not
> >     > think
> >     >     > that a
> >     >     >     device can generate out-of-order data....
> >     >     >
> >     >     >     For example, If you write two devices' data into one
> > TsFile, it
> >     > is ok
> >     >     > if
> >     >     >     you write data like:
> >     >     >     - d1.t1, d1.t2, d2.t1, d2.t2, d2.t3, d1.t4, d1.t5 ....
> >     >     >     or:
> >     >     >     - d1.m1.t1, d1.m1.t2, d1.m2.t1, d1.m2.t2, d2.m1.t1 ...
> >     >     >
> >     >     >     But you can not write data like:
> >     >     >     - d1.m1.t2, d1.m1.t1 ...

> >     >     >     >     IoTDB can support either on a server with 7*24 or a
> >     > RaspberryPi.
> >     >     > We
> >     >     >     > have
> >     >     >     >     tested both the two scenario.
> >     >     >     >
> >     >     >     >     When you shutdown an IoTDB instance in force (e.g.,
> > power
> >     > off)
> >     >     > and
> >     >     >     > restart
> >     >     >     >     it again, no data loses ( if you enable the WAL).
> >     >     >     >
> >     >     >     >     However, currently we do not optimize the time cost
> > of the
> >     >     > restart
> >     >     >     > process.
> >     >     >     >     It is an important feature that we need to do,
> > because we
> >     > hope
> >     >     > IoTDB
> >     >     >     > can
> >     >     >     >     support data management either on the edge devices
> > or the
> >     > data
> >     >     > center.
> >     >     >     >
> >     >     >     >     And, the default configuration is not so suitable
> for
> >     > running on
> >     >     > the
> >     >     >     > edge
> >     >     >     >     device. (e.g., block size is 128MB, which is too
> > large for
> >     > a
> >     >     >     > RaspberryPi,
> >     >     >     >     and will slow down the restart process because
> there
> > are
> >     > too
> >     >     > much WAL
> >     >     >     > data
> >     >     >     >     on disk).
